Rubini / Piotto
Rubini / Piotto brings together two young Argentine players, each arriving from a partnership already active on tour. Juan Ignacio Rubini had partnered Maximiliano Sanchez on the Premier Padel circuit, while Ignacio Piotto won an FIP Star title in Mauritius partnering Thomas Leygue. The two build this partnership from those separate starting points, early in both careers.
